Output c18e8ce1b7824c563aaeeb02331d133a1efaf2add50387019efb9be4e2476738:0

value
1002560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 622c27eb361d62e660e4a4f3ea74a7a034eb3c77 OP_EQUAL
address
3Ae73MKTY74ZRjuXw5CNZqci3sYrgEZDkn
transaction
c18e8ce1b7824c563aaeeb02331d133a1efaf2add50387019efb9be4e2476738
spent
true